Wanghongjie Qiu is a pioneering researcher in the field of underwater wearable robotics, with a focus on augmenting human capabilities in extreme aquatic environments. His primary research areas include reconfigurable robotic design, human-robot interaction, and assistive technologies for divers. Qiu’s major contributions center on the development of an "underwater superlimb"—a wearable robot that provides divers with mobility assistance and frees their hands for tool manipulation. His 2023 paper on this topic, which has garnered 6 citations, introduces a thrust vectoring system using 3D-printed, waterproofed modules, showcasing innovative design and modeling for diving assistance. Additionally, Qiu has advanced underwater intention recognition, as demonstrated in his 2023 work with 3 citations, which uses head motion and throat vibration to enable natural human-robot interaction in challenging underwater settings. This multi-modal mechanism addresses the severe limitations divers face in expressing intent, marking a significant step toward seamless robotic assistance. Qiu’s work is notable for its practical impact, bridging robotics and marine engineering to enhance safety and efficiency in underwater operations, making him a rising figure in assistive robotics.
